SB 2082: Saboor Grieving Parents Act

GENERAL BILL by Webster ; (CO-INTRODUCERS) Cowin ; Campbell

Saboor Grieving Parents Act; provides that where health practitioner has custody of fetal remains following spontaneous fetal demise, health practitioner must notify mother of her option of burial or cremation of fetal remains; provides that where facility has custody of fetal remains following spontaneous fetal demise, facility must notify mother of her option of burial or cremation of fetal remains, as well as procedures pertaining thereto, etc. creates 383.33625.

Effective Date: 05/27/2003
Last Action: 5/27/2003 - Approved by Governor; Chapter No. 2003-52
